Answer: [tex]h(x)=10(0.4)^x[/tex]
Step-by-step explanation:
The exponential function h, represented in the table, can be written as [tex]h(x)=ab^x[/tex]
From table, at x=0, h(x) =10
Put theses values in equation,, we get
[tex]10=a.b^0\\\\\Rightarrow\ 10= a (1)\\\\\Rightarrow\ a= 10[/tex]
Also, for x= 1 , h(x) = 4, so put these values and a=10 in the equation , we get
[tex]4=10b^1\\\\\Rightarrow\ b=\dfrac{4}{10}\\\\\Rightarrow\ b= 0.4[/tex]
Put value of a and b in the equation ,
[tex]h(x)=10(0.4)^x[/tex] → Required equation.
